Transaction 59840d41c12123d71071338945beab20f1614312d115bf353e06c871d8fb1a74
1 Input
1 Output
-
59840d41c12123d71071338945beab20f1614312d115bf353e06c871d8fb1a74:0
- value
- 50008059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bc8f5d80b8e662573567937384477b7eeab9527 OP_EQUAL
- address
- 32mL6d3Wr8wi66BKUm9vzsBDKCjBJwGZkX